Description
Brookline, MA: David R, Godine Poster. Near Fine. Poster. First Printing. 22" w x 31" h. A handsome broadside, 22" w x 31" h, featuring a 15" h x 20 ' w photogravure, printed by Joh. Enschede, Zonen, Haarlem, Holland, portraying a Civil War encampment with wounded soldiers resting beneath trees. Underneath, the quote, taken from Whitman's "Democratic Vistas:, note 2. "The whole present system of the officering and personnel of the army and navy of these States, and the spirit and letter of their trebly-aristocratic rules and regulations, is a monstrous exotic, a nuisance and revolt, and belong here just as much as orders of nobility, or the Pope's council of cardinals. I say if the present theory of our army and navy is sensible and true, then the rest of America is an unmitigated fraud. Walt Whitman". Printed on Cartridge Paper made by Schut, Heelsum, Holland and calligraphy by Bram De Does. No date, circa 1972. Near Fine, faint creases at edges. SCARCE.
